Magellan GPS 4000

Hand-held global positioning system

[GPS 4000]

For the outdoor enthusiast who wants more in a GPS - bigger memory for landmarks and routes, more navigation screens, more features like landmark messaging, map projection, sunrise/sunset times, moon phase, and a real-time plotter with additional functions - the GPS 4000 delivers more than you could imagine in a 283 gram portable receiver.

Based on the same ease-of-use performance, rugged design and sturdy construction as the GPS 2000, the GPS 4000 has enhanced features for mapping, real-time plotting and navigating. User-definable navigation screens have been added for displaying your most-often used readouts, and a road screen illustrates distance travelled and orientation to destination.

An enhancement over the GPS 2000, the moving-map track plotter on the GPS 4000 updates your progress in real time, showing your course as you move, the route you set and all landmarks in your field of view. In the 4000, the adjustable scale plotter pans in any direction, giving you a view of other portions of your route and all the nearby landmarks you have saved. You can "Go To" any one of those landmarks or move the cursor and immediately create one. And for 25 of those landmarks the GPS 4000 lets you attach a two-line message so you can add additional information about those locations. Experienced map readers will appreciate the GPS 4000's map projection and triangulation features, allowing them to create new landmarks by estimating distance and direction to remote locations. A handy "I'm here" feature takes the guesswork out of plotting the exact UTM coordinate point on a map.

The GPS 4000 is amazingly versatile too. The 4000 can calculate sunrise/sunset times and moon phase for any place in the world on any date, helping hikers, backpackers, skiers and fishermen to pre-plan their activities.

6 easy-to-follow graphic navigation screens

Adjustable-scale moving-map track plotter displays your progress in real time and allows you to view other areas

2 user-definable navigation screens

Easy-to-use on-screen menus

"Go To" key quickly sets a route

Store 200 locations (landmarks), attaching a 20-character message to 25 of them

Save 5 reversible routes of 15 legs

Backtrack feature lets you retrace your steps

Calculate sunrise/sunset times and moon phase for any saved landmark

Project landmarks using a map, compass or line-of-sight

Displays your position in latitude/longitude, UTM and OSGB coordinates

"I'm here" feature lets you easily transfer coordinates from your GPS to a map

Satellite status screen

Backlit display for night use

Highly sensitive, built-in antenna

Rugged design with scratch-proof display

Up to 17 hours of continuous use on just 4 AA alkaline batteries

Power management features protect saved locations

Optional power/data module allows you to connect to 10-16 VDC and output GPS data to other compatible NMEA electronic devices

Connects to optional remote antenna for use in a vehicle or below deck on a boat

Weatherproof, pocket-sized and lightweight; only 283 grams
